Software Qa Automation Tester Resume
4.00/5 (Submit Your Rating)
SUMMARY:
- Seeking a position as a Software QA AutomationTester in the challenging IT industry, to utilize my ability and skills that present professional growth while being flexible, innovative and resourceful.
- Over 7years of professional experience in Software Quality assurance in various domains with Manual and Automation Testing, Verification and Validation and software Quality Assurance.
- Expertise in developing Test Strategy, Test conditions, Test Plan, Test Scenarios, Test Case Design and Test Reports using business/functional requirements for both manual and automated tests.
- Excellent understanding in all aspects of Software Development Life Cycle (SDLC), with specific focus on Software Testing Life Cycle (STLC), Defect Life Cycle and role of QA.
- Strong expertise on Requirements Analyzing, Test Planning, Test Design, Test Execution, Defect Reporting, Defect Status Reporting, Test Closure activities.
- Excellent experience in working with Test Management Tools like HP Quality Center/ALM.
- Expertise in problem solving, finding the root cause of the issue, Defect tracking and defect retest.
- Comprehensive knowledge using HP QTP/UFT, HP Quality Center/ALM.
- Experienced in design of test Plan, reviewing, prioritizing and executing test cases and defect logging using HP Quality Center/ALM.
- Performed System, Functional and Regression testing on different modules in latest builds using Quick Test Professional (QTP).
- Designed &developed automation scripts for master regression suite using HP UFT/QTP, VBScript.
- Experienced on Developing and Maintaining Data Driven and Keyword Driven Automation Framework.
- Expertize in developing reusable functions with static and dynamic Descriptive Programming.
- Extensive experience in Error Handling by developing custom error handling functions with VB Script .
- Experienced in back - end testing using SQL Queries.
- Experienced in Agile Scrum development methodology.
- Experienced in Sprint Grooming, Sprint Planning, Sprint Review and Sprint Retrospective meetings.
- Experienced in mentoring colleagues in Test Automation Development.
- Documented Daily Test Summary Reports for each Test execution.
- Conceptual thinker, highly motivated, self-starter with good communication and interpersonal skills.
TECHNICAL SKILLS:
Operating Systems: Windows 95, 98, 2000, XP, 7, Linux, OSX and UNIX
Automation Tools: Quick Test Professional, UFT, Selenium IDE,, SoapUI
Test Management Tools: HP Quality Center, ALM, Jira, Team Foundation Server
Databases: Oracle, MS SQL Server, DB2 and MS Access
Programming Languages: VB Script, SQL, HTML, XML, JAVA, Groovy, Appian
Defect Tracking Tools: HP Quality Center, ALM, Jira, Team Foundation Server
Testing Methods: Component, Integration, System, Regression and UAT, API (Web Services)testing
PROFESSIONAL EXPERIENCE:
Confidential
Software QA Automation Tester- Generated Test Strategies and Test Plans to thoroughly test various areas of the application
- Led a team of 4-6 testers performing manual front end and back end functional testing
- Responsible for writing Functional Test Cases based on technical specifications and business requirements
- Responsible for Capacity & Resource Planning to ensure QC Sign-off of various functional areas
- Designed proposals for resolving conflicts and prepared weekly and daily reports including Bug Status Reports and Test Execution Reports
- Executed Test Cases to validate product compliance with requirements
- Involved in the bug triage meetings with developers to validate the severity of bugs
- Conducted Root Cause Analysis to assist development team with efficient defect resolution
- Involved in the Backlog Grooming sessions with the Product Owners and the BA’s
- Collaborated with Product Owners and BSAs to groom functional requirements
- Involved in Sprint Planning/Commitment meetings to help build the Sprint Backlog for each sprint
- Developed Functional and UI test cases using Zephyr add-in for JIRA
- Performed Test activities using JIRA to ensure integration into functional requirements
- Developed and executed complex SQL Queries to perform Backend Testing
- Performed Regression Testing, Smoke Testing, using HP UFT
- Tested CMS project related to Legacy Database scenarios creating UFT scripts with Dictionary Object global and application specific functions
- Made different POCs in order to improve Keyword Frameworks
- Created UFT scripts in order to run wave processes in Appian Process Model
- Created UFT scripts in order to change/create passwords in Appian Process Model
- Created UFT scripts in order to run exception batches in Appian Process Model
- Created UFT scripts in order to expedite Deferred Payment processes in Appian Process Model
- Created UFT scripts to run changes in MySql and Appian Process Model operations
Confidential
Software QA AutomationTester- Understand functional and technical aspects of the system and convert the requirements into test scenarios.
- Reviewing functional requirements and decompose scenarios into detailed test cases.
- Strong experience in Smoke Testing, Functional Testing, Regression Testing, User Acceptance Testing, Automation Testing.
- Expertize in reporting defects and verifying fixes.
- Provided oversight in writing detailed design steps and created the test lab for the projects in ALM.
- Regularly followed up with the development team to discuss the defects identified during Testing.
- Designed and Developed Keyword Driven Framework using QTP/UFT from scratch.
- Developed reusable functions and maintained in the function libraries.
- Developed error handling functions using VB Script in QTP/UFT.
- Developed driver scripts and scheduled daily automation shakeout to test the system stability.
- Executed automation scripts in batch mode on multiple virtual machines simultaneously to improve the test execution efficiency.
- Developed scripts to validate web application’s labels and values with high accuracy using HTML DOM (Document Object Model) using QTP.
- Used custom HTML test report to improve the readability of QTP run results.
- Updated test automation scripts for new UI and Functional changes in the application.
- Executed automation regression suite on various test environments.
- Analyzed the test run result and logged defects in the HP ALM.
- Mentored functional testers on VB Script and Test automation for adapting cross functional teamforagile scrum environment.
- Described QTP/UFT base framework to Selenium team in order to transfer existing framework to Selenium base framework
- Participated in daily scrum, sprint grooming, sprint planning,sprint review and retro meetings.
- Supported manual functional testing on demand.
- Worked closely with SME’s to determined and prioritized regression suite test cases for test automation.
- Participatedintest case rationalization for improving the overall testing effort by reducing redundancy.
- Executed automation scripts using API (Web Services) testing
- Performed cross browser testing on IE, Firefox and Chrome for browser compatibility.
- Reported test execution result to the project team and provided detailed analysis.
Confidential
Software QA AutomationTester- Understand functional and technical aspects of the system and convert the requirements into test scenarios.
- Developed Traceability Matrix to ensure testing coverage.
- Attended walk though meeting in which business rules and functionalities were discussed.
- Coordinated all QA activities and enhancements using Agile Methodology.
- Developed Test Plan and wrote Test Cases.
- Performed Sanity testing, System testing, Functional testing, Integration testing, Web testing and GUI testing.
- Performed Cross browser compatibility testing and cross platform compatibility.
- Prepared Test scenarios based on the BRD document and desired application flow.
- Used SQL Queries to verify and validate Data populated in Front-End is consistent with that of Backend.
- Developed test scripts using QTP with Descriptive Programming using VB Script.
- Developed keyword driven framework using QTP from scratch.
- Executed and Maintained automation framework in QTP.
- Executed QTP regression scripts for each regression cycle and logged defect for all test failures in ALM.
- Performed back-end testing using complex SQL Queries.
- Developed reusable functions and reusable actions in QTP to improve the framework efficiency.
- Attended requirement review and provided feedback to the business team.
- Lead test case review with project team to ensure testing scope and coverage.
Confidential
Software QA AutomationTester- Involved in designing, developing and maintaining Keyword driven framework.
- Automated Regression suite and Smoke test scenarios using QTP.
- Created Driver script for hourly smoke test run including nightly test run.
- Supported daily deployment by executing test script and analyzing the test result.
- Supported load testing by creating XML test data using QTP XML Automation.
- Created Custom functions using QTP to handle complex and dynamic application to improve framework efficiency and reduced execution time.
- Worked closely with SME’s to analyze application functionality for best automation practice.
- Supported manual testing whenever it is needed.
- Executed scripts to perform Regression Testing using QTP.
- Involved to setup QTP Test Environment configuration on Users systems.
- Designed Test Plan and Test Cases as per the requirements.
- Automated Test Cases for GUI, Functionality and regression testing using QTP
- Rigorously Developed& updated automation scripts using Quick Test Pro on different functionalities of the application.
- Performed regression testing for fixes using QTP and closed the defects in ALM.
- Point of Contact for the automation team, in case of any deviation of Test Results as compared to the Manual Testing Team’s Test Results.
- Running Smoke Tests for several teams on the project, for stability and minor changes in the application.
- Performed Application Functional Testing, System testing, and Regression testing.
- Performing smoke test for all the releases and verifying the fixes and closing them.
Confidential
Software QA AutomationTester- Responsible for Overall QA and UAT effort including creating, executing and monitoring testing of ITCC Advantage application.
- Responsible for developing, executing and maintainingdata driven framework for ITCC Advantage application.
- Automated test cases for GUI, Functionality and Regression testing using QTP.
- Developed& updated automation scripts using QTP on different functionalities of the application.
- Performing smoke test for all the releases and verifying the fixes and closing them.
- Actively participated with the users during User Acceptance Test (UAT).
- Created Test Reports throughout all the phases of test effort.
- Performed extensive back end testing in Microsoft SQL Server environment.
- Extensive experience writing SQL Queries and Involved in Data Base Testing.
- Performing smoke test for all the releases and verifying the fixes and closing them.
- Performed production support for major releases.
- Interviewed end-user in call center to get feedback for the application in order to improve the user experience.
- Actively participated with the users during User Acceptance Test (UAT).
- Created Test Reports throughout all the faces of test effort.
- Involved in Estimating Time Efforts based on test plans and business requirements.
